1

An Unbiased View of ppc agency Liverpool

News Discuss 
The company gives services like digital strategies, World wide web development, visual communication, and online brand methods. They Merge creativeness with technological expertise to offer individualized remedies for bettering manufacturer performance and buyer interactions within the digital Area. Epic New Media can be a Liverpool-based digital marketing agency that concentrates https://localseoservicesliverpool63962.slypage.com/37913238/getting-my-top-liverpool-digital-marketing-agencies-to-work

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story